I was looking at the Skill matching category and I couldn't understand :
If there is an employer that wish to hire me then my visa will be approved and I will be able to work and stay in Australia ?
Does it have to be the same job description as in my Skill matching ? How long does it take to be approved ?
Do you have more details regarding the type and definition of the employer ?

Hi Haifa

If an employer selects your CV from the Skills matching database then he can sponsor you for a Long-Stay Temporary Business Visa, which would allow you to work in Australia for that employer for up to four years. He might even be able to sponsor you for permanent residency if he lives in a Designated Area of Australia. Yes, the employer who will potential employ you needs to offer you a position similar to the job description you provide on the application. The application only takes a few weeks to be "approved" but this does not guarantee you a job - this just means that your CV will be placed in a database available to potential employers. All Australian government and certain Designated Area and Pre-Sponsored employers have access to this skill matching database.
